Utilisation Rate

Utilisation Rate refers to the extent to which a company or organization uses its available resources. It is a key performance indicator in various contexts: Manufacturing: The percentage of production capacity that is actually being used. For example, if a factory operates at 80% utilisation, it means 80% of its production potential is being utilized. Workforce: The proportion of available working hours that employees are productively engaged in their tasks. Equipment: The ratio of time that machinery or equipment is in active use compared to its total available time.
